Decent but LOUD

From: -Anonymous-
Date posted: 2/23/2004
Years at this apartment: 2002 - 2004
 
The Arboretum is overall nice apartment complex built mainly for college students. The clubhouse, which also houses the leasing office, has a nice exercise facility and a pool. All well and good. But what you are paying for is the APARTMENT.

At first glance, the apartments are great. New construction (between 2000 and 2002), neutral beige plush carpet, wide door-walls to the balconies/patios, light oak cabinets, and frosted flourescent overhead lighting fixtures. Each apartment comes with a dishwasher, plus a full-size washer and dryer. Great!

What is NOT great about the Aboretum apartments is the noise, the quality of the construction, and the visitor parking situation. In the two years I've lived here, I have had problems several times a month with neighbors having loud parties any night of the week. If they migrate into the hallway, it's like having a few dozen more roommates. If they smoke, it's like they are smoking right in your face (no insulation around the doors). The walls are paperthin - if I want to know what's on a different TV station, I just mute my TV and listen for the one across the hall.

The appliances are at least name-brand, but not exactly top-of-the-line. Electric bills and heating (gas heat) are higher than normal, probably due in part to the inferior appliances. Although I would rather have a 1-star d/w than none at all.

Visitor parking sucks. For the hundreds of residents at the Arboretum, they've allowed for *maybe* a dozen or so visitor parking spaces. You can imagine what the situation is like on party nights. Some people park a mile or two away and then have the host come pick them up. OTOH, the parking for residents is great. I can always find a space within 20 feet of my door.

If you want to continue that frat house experience, ie lots of parties, tons of college students, and the meat market at the pool in the summer, the Arboretum is just the place for you. If you want a place where you can come home and relax in the peace and quiet, look elsewhere.
